NM27C128Q150 Description

NM27C128Q150 Description

The NM27C128Q150 is a 128Kbit EPROM (Erasable Programmable Read-Only Memory) IC designed for parallel memory interface applications. Manufactured by onsemi, this memory chip features a 16K x 8 memory organization, providing a total of 128Kbits of storage capacity. It is housed in a through-hole 28CDIP package, making it suitable for applications requiring robust and reliable physical mounting.

The NM27C128Q150 operates within a supply voltage range of 4.5V to 5.5V and has an access time of 150 nanoseconds, ensuring fast data retrieval. It is designed to function within an operating temperature range of 0°C to 70°C (TA), making it suitable for a variety of industrial and consumer applications. The chip is classified under ECCN EAR99 and HTSUS 8542.32.0061, indicating compliance with international trade regulations. Additionally, it is REACH unaffected, ensuring compliance with environmental and chemical regulations.

NM27C128Q150 Features

  • Memory Capacity: 128Kbit (16K x 8 organization) provides ample storage for firmware and critical data.
  • Fast Access Time: 150 ns access time ensures rapid data retrieval, enhancing system performance.
  • Operating Temperature: 0°C to 70°C (TA) makes it suitable for a wide range of environmental conditions.
  • Voltage Range: 4.5V to 5.5V supply voltage ensures compatibility with standard 5V systems.
  • Parallel Interface: The parallel memory interface allows for efficient data transfer and integration with existing systems.
  • Through-Hole Mounting: The through-hole package type ensures robust and reliable physical mounting, ideal for industrial applications.
  • Compliance: REACH unaffected and ECCN EAR99 classification ensure compliance with environmental and international trade regulations.
